| Back | sul∙fate, sul∙fide, sul∙fur, sul∙fur∙ic acid(NAmE) = sulphate , sulphide , sulphur , sulphuric acid / ˈsʌlfə(r) / ◙ noun [U] • (symb S) a chemical element. Sulphur is a pale yellow substance that produces a strong unpleasant smell when it burns and is used in medicine and industry. • 硫;硫磺 ♦ sul∙phur∙ous (BrE) (NAmE sul∙fur∙ous) /ˈsʌlfərəs / adj.: »sulphurous fumes 燃烧硫磺产生的烟雾 |
